Battery

The key fob is an essential part of your Nissan key fob. It lets you unlock the doors, start your engine, and use other key functions. If it doesn't work, you probably want to know what the problem is. Fortunately, you can repair it by replacing the battery.

A brand new CR2032 battery can be bought at a hardware or discount supermarket for a affordable price. You'll need a small flat-headed screwdriver for prying the back of your key fob. Most models have a tiny tab or notch that you can slot your screwdriver into to separate the fob into two pieces. After you have opened the fob, you can remove the old battery and then insert the new one, making sure it's oriented correctly.

Depending on the model of your Nissan It is possible to confirm that the new battery is of the correct type. This information is usually located in the owner's manual or on the back of the fob that you use to open the key. After you've purchased the right battery, put it back in the fob, snap the cover back shut, and test it to make sure it works. Keyless Entry

We have some positive news for you in case you think that your key fob does nothing more than unlock and lock your car. Certain modern fobs can be used to roll down your windows, or even start the engine when you hold your keys at the rear bumper.

These modern systems employ RFID technology, unlike the old-fashioned keys that only had two or three locks. The key fob is equipped with a microchip which has a unique frequency. This enables it to communicate with the receiver of your car and unlock the trunk or doors. The majority of models will recognize you when you approach by using the fob, meaning it will know to automatically unlock and start your vehicle.

Certain models let you open the trunk by waggling your key behind the car. This can be extremely useful if your hands are full of luggage or groceries. The key fob also has a button that will allow you to start your vehicle by pressing it onto the steering wheel. This system can be activated when you press the brake or clutch when you press the START/STOP buttons.
